Steve Martin, Lili Taylor, John Hodgman, and More Will Appear at Elevator Repair Service's 2019 Spring Gala
by Stephi Wild - Apr 18, 2019


Lecy Goranson will host a star-studded gala, celebrating this year's achievements of the Obie-Award winning theater ensemble, Elevator Repair Service. Under the direction of founding Artistic Director John Collins, ERS has been making original theater for 27 years. They have achieved national and international recognition with their extensive body of work, in particular the award-winning Gatz, a verbatim staging of The Great Gatsby, which enjoyed four engagements this season, from Abu Dhabi to Perth to New York City. BWW Exclusive: Listen to 'White Male World' from THE JONATHAN LARSON PROJECT Album!
by Nicole Rosky - Apr 4, 2019


Ghostlight Records has announced that The Jonathan Larson Project is available for digital download and streaming tomorrow, Friday, April 5. The album features the music of the late Jonathan Larson, the generation-defining writer of Rent and tick, tick… BOOM!, the former an iconic Broadway landmark and the latter a beloved musical gem. The Jonathan Larson Project is an evening of Jonathan's unheard work featuring songs from never-produced shows like 1984 and Superbia; songs that were cut from Rent and tick, tick… BOOM!; songs written for both theatrical revues and for the radio; songs about politics, love and New York City; including many never before publicly performed or recorded.
